Blood before pride is the new band bringing the ruckus to your speakers as they serve their debut single “Looking Down the Barrel of a Gun.” which is a hard hitting version of the legendary Beastie Boys song of the same name (off their sophomore LP Paul’s Boutique)
The head-banging, rap-meets-rock cover features guest vocals from Brownsville rap veterans Rock and Lil Fame. Straying away from the usual, verse per emcee, the trio integrate perfectly into the vocals throughout the entirety of single making the flow very effortless and engaging without losing the vibe and energy. The video was directed by The Last American B-Boy.
Fronted by Staten Island’s own Phil Anastasia, and including group member, bassist Ryan Kienle of Matchbook Romance, Blood Before Pride are clearly ready to make some noise with this riff-heavy banger that sounds straight from the classic Judgment Night soundtrack.
“Looking Down the Barrel of a Gun.” is off BBP’s upcoming album, Mimesis, Catharsis, and the Imitation of Art in Life.
